Is DA a reliable domain metric?
I use DA and PA every day for reporting, researching and most of the time it's a pretty good metric to compare domains and pages but recently I did an experiment and I was surprised when I saw the results. Two months ago I "link bombed" one of my old, unused websites with thousands of spammy blog comment links. Before the attack, its DA was 21 with a few hundred links. In August, after the recent OSE update I checked the website again and I was quite surprised to see DA 61 as a results of 8340 links. A DA value over 60 is considered pretty strong and it's interesting to see that spammy blog comment links could change it so significantly. Someone who doesn't know the history of the domain might get interested in advertising on such websites because the mozbar shows a high DA value. I know it's difficult to algorithmically differentiate between spammy and valuable blogs but a future OSE update could focus on this issue. Let me know what you think.
